About this book

"Jock of the Bushveld" by Sir Percy FitzPatrick is a novel written in the early 20th century. This tale draws readers into the rich landscape and adventures of the South African Bushveld, revolving around the life of a boy and his beloved dog, Jock, who becomes a central figure in their experiences. The narrative provides insight into the relationship between humans and animals, as well as the challenges and beauty of life in the wild. The opening of "Jock of the Bushveld" sets the stage for a story that weaves together themes of companionship, adventure, and resilience. It introduces the narrator's reflections on the nature of loneliness and the individuality of those who inhabit the remote areas of the veld. Key characters such as the boy, the loyal yet unconventional dog, Jess, and various other figures contribute to a vibrant tableau of life. As the narrative unfolds, we see the boy’s determination to seek his fortune despite warnings, a journey that hints at both personal growth and the trials he will face in the vast, untamed wilderness alongside his steadfast canine companion, Jock.

Sir Percy FitzPatrick's "Jock of the Bushveld" is a classic adventure novel recounting the true-life exploits of a boy and his remarkable dog, Jock, in the rugged South African Bushveld during the late 19th century. The narrative chronicles Jock's birth as the runt of the litter and his transformation into an exceptionally brave, loyal, and intelligent hunting dog, indispensable to Fitzpatrick's life as a transport rider. Through a series of vivid and often perilous adventures—including encounters with wild animals, dangerous journeys, and the challenges of frontier life—the book explores the profound bond between humans and animals. It's a nostalgic ode to a bygone era, offering insights into the natural world, the spirit of companionship, and the harsh realities of survival in an untamed land.

Key themes

The Bond Between Humans and Animals
The central theme exploring the profound and often spiritual connection between Percy FitzPatrick and Jock. The book illustrates how this bond transcends mere ownership, becoming a partnership based on mutual trust, understanding, and shared experiences of danger and companionship. It highlights the emotional depth of animal relationships and their impact on human lives.
Survival in the Wilderness
This theme delves into the constant struggle for existence in the untamed South African Bushveld. It showcases the resourcefulness, courage, and resilience required by both humans and animals to navigate a harsh environment filled with natural predators, unpredictable weather, and the challenges of transport riding. It's a testament to the primal instincts and practical skills needed to endure.
Nature's Beauty and Brutality
The book vividly portrays the duality of nature: its breathtaking beauty, vastness, and intricate ecosystems, contrasted with its unforgiving brutality, where life is a constant struggle and death is an ever-present reality. FitzPatrick does not shy away from depicting the harsh realities of the food chain and the dangers inherent in the wild, while also celebrating its awe-inspiring grandeur.
